  • There is a REALLY nice low, marble ledge down a 3 set outside the Buttermarket, next to BHS. Although, if you're goofy, you're not gonna get much put down on it unless you skate well backside, slides don't work well.

  • Plenty of street spots including Fisons, Greyfriars, the Church, the big Halfords, the College and Crown pools. Greyfriars is best: two good banks and loads of waxed curbs and manual blocks. Fisons is good too: it's all marble Ñ steps, a big four and an eight or nine and marble drops too. Crown Pools has a big set of eight and a nice four.
